Compelling Introduction In the bustling region of Ghaziabad within the Delhi NCR, where the hustle of city life meets the desire for seamless travel experiences, check here TRAVBROAD PVT LTD emerges as a beacon of reliability and expertise. With a strong presence in the automotive travel industry, TRAVBROAD PVT LTD in Ghaziabad has established itse